Output 324acb8b3464044084966956dbec05e0ee887af12896c96e76481ca234dc4f5b:1

value
29694810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45acea50cba221b0a3a63bd7bd6180665da7e0fc OP_EQUAL
address
383Rh9PNkLLyV4J7TuvPGkxAvsXmYEq5QK
transaction
324acb8b3464044084966956dbec05e0ee887af12896c96e76481ca234dc4f5b
spent
true